Zinc Chalcogenide Based Shell Layers for Colloidal Quantum Wells
A new synthetic route is developed for the synthesis of CdSe/ZnSe/ZnS multi‐shell nanoplatelets (NPLs) with emissions between 615 and 630 nm and photoluminescence quantum yields up to 90%. Control over the lateral size of the starting CdSe core enabled the narrowing of the emission linewidth to 20 nm.

An Atomic‐Scale View at γ’‐Fe4N as Hydrogen Barrier Material
This study demonstrates the efficacy of γ’‐Fe4N nitride layers, formed via gas nitriding, as hydrogen permeation barriers. Advanced characterization, hydrogen permeation analysis, and DFT calculations reveal a 20 fold reduction in hydrogen diffusion at room temperature.
